import React from 'react'; import { highlightLinesInWorker } from '@/components/chat/markdown/markdown-worker'; // Tokenize a whole block ONCE in the Shiki worker and expose per-line inner // HTML. For per-line layouts (diffs, gutters, virtualization) that would // otherwise spawn one highlighter per row. Returns `null` until the first // result lands (or permanently on failure) — callers render plain text then. // // Whole-block tokenization also restores cross-line syntax context (multi-line // strings / comments) that independent per-line highlighting loses. export const useWorkerHighlightedLines = (code: string, language: string): string[] | null => { const [lines, setLines] = React.useState(null); React.useEffect(() => { let active = true; setLines(null); void highlightLinesInWorker(code, (language || 'text').toLowerCase()).then((result) => { if (active) setLines(result); }); return () => { active = false; }; }, [code, language]); return lines; };
